I think that accountability is a problem, but again, remember that we appear to have a further complication in that Comolli isn't just handed a budget for transfer fees and wages and allowed free rein as his counterparts on the continent appear to be. He has to operate within a policy laid down by Levy. For all we know, he and Jol may have been in far closer agreement over the type of player we needed for footballing purposes than many appear to think; we had a hint of that when Jol mentioned that 'we' had thought about players such as Distin and Chivu for the CB position before going for Kaboul.
Within those constraints, Comolli hasn't done too badly. Have we signed any total turkeys? I'm not Zokora's greatest fan, but if I've been seriously underwhelmed I also wouldn't say he's been total rubbish; just think back a few years, to the crap Graham and Hoddle and Francis managed to sign. They may not have had the funding we've enjoyed over the past three or four seasons, but they weren't exactly starved of dosh either, and a goodly proportion of the money was pissed away on has-beens and never-wases, and the odd quality player such as Rebrov who was completely the wrong buy at the time. I think Comolli has done rather better than that, but our problem is we're long on potential but rather short on ready-to-run quality where it really matters.
If there are any positives to be drawn from this horror-show of a season, it's that we now have a much clearer definition of roles; I also suspect that Ramos will have a lot more clout than Jol, and we may see that exercised in January. Levy may have shown, yet again, that whilst he is a whizz at making money he has dreadful timing when it comes to the firing of managers, but I can't believe he's so dim that he hasn't realised that we didn't buy the right players this summer.
